FP17 SYC is a 2017 Vauxhall Vivaro in White with a 1,598cc diesel engine. This vehicle has been through 10 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 80%.
Across all 2017 Vauxhall Vivaro models, the average MOT pass rate is 76.2% with a typical mileage of 72,647 miles. This particular vehicle has performed better than the average for its year.
The most common reason a Vauxhall Vivaro fails its MOT is track rod end ball joint has excessive play, accounting for 144,341 recorded failures. If you're considering buying FP17 SYC,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Vauxhall Vivaro typically stays on UK roads for around 24 years. At 9 years old, this Vauxhall Vivaro is still in the earlier part of its expected life.
